Before we begin, it is worth mentioning that not all mice are compatible with MediaLauncher TV Box. Make sure to use a mouse that comes with a USB receiver rather than a Bluetooth one. Additionally, the mouse should be plug-and-play, meaning that it doesn’t require any driver installation.
Step 1: Connect the USB Receiver to MediaLauncher TV Box
The first step is to connect the USB receiver to MediaLauncher TV Box. Locate the USB port on the back of the device and insert the USB receiver into it. Once inserted, the TV Box will automatically detect the mouse.
Step 2: Turn on the Mouse
Next, turn on the mouse by pressing the power button. The mouse should start working immediately.
Step 3: Use the Mouse to Navigate the Interface
Now that the mouse is connected and turned on, you can start using it to navigate the MediaLauncher TV Box interface. You can move the cursor by simply moving the mouse. You can also click on items on the screen by using the left mouse button and right-click by using the right mouse button. Additionally, you can scroll on the screen by using the scroll wheel.
Step 4: Customize the Mouse Settings
MediaLauncher TV Box offers several customization options to make your mouse experience more convenient. To access the mouse settings, go to “Settings” > “Mouse and Trackpad.” From there, you can change the cursor speed, double-click speed, and scroll speed.
